Why were some people against mandal commission recommendattion

Mandal commission recommended for 27% reservation

in jobs in government and public sector. Also an age relaxation of 5 to 10

years was to be given to those classes.  It was in 1980. Mandal commission submitted its re then President Sri N Sanjiva Reddy.


 


   Prime Minister VP Singh announced the complete implementation of Mandal commission's recommendations as an order (ordinance) in 1990. It created a lot of stir among

people of forward  castes and other castes.  Suddenly they would lose

jobs available to them. Many unemployed were not in OBC but they were not

economically or socially well off. So reservations were a big hurdle for them.


 


   


    Using caste as backwardness is not

appropriate.  Using caste for reservation results in unfair treatment of

other castes.  Also the performance of government and public sectors will

suffer badly.  Also using caste for reservations is against the promise of equality to everyone - as mentioned in the constitution.
